#2fc147 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2fc147 is composed of 18.4% red, 75.7%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.2%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 129.9 degrees, a saturation of 60.8% and a lightness of 47.1%. #2fc147 color hex could be obtained by blending #5eff8e with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#2fc147
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010401 is the darkest color, while #f3fcf4 is the lightest one.
